Faulds heading to fourth Olympics
Olympic gold medallist Richard Faulds leads Britain's five-strong shooting team for the Beijing Games in August.
Faulds, 31, is aiming to replicate his double trap victory of eight years ago in Sydney alongside Steve Scott, 23.
Jon Hammond, 27, will compete in the 50m rifle prone, 50m rifle three positions and air rifle events.
Charlotte Kerwood, 21, who won Commonwealth Games gold in 2002 and 2006, and Elena Little, 35, compete in the shotgun and skeet respectively.

Scott said: "I am chuffed to be taking part in the greatest sporting event in the world, but it hasn't really sunk in yet that I am going to Beijing.
"When I get on the plane, that's when I will get nervous."
Team GB shooting team leader John Leighton-Dyson added: "There are four new Olympians all of whom have qualified against the best in the world and we have high hopes of good results in Beijing.
"Richard has been shooting exceptionally well and he is an excellent medal prospect going in to his fourth Olympics."
Faulds won the World English Clay Sporting Championship in Suffolk last weekend.
